Vendor Managed Inventory Analyst III maintains the customer's inventory replenishment levels and stock models based on approved schedule and agreed-upon targets. Monitors and analyzes utilization, product availability, pricing, and lead times to prepare VMI models. Being a Vendor Managed Inventory Analyst III understands all VMI parameters, calculations and data feeds to accurately generate replenishment orders. Develops reports to track all metrics and identify trends or issues that impact inventory levels. Additionally, Vendor Managed Inventory Analyst III expedites and resolves any shipping, delivery, ordering or system issues that may impact expected inventory replenishment targets. Requires a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a manager or head of a unit/department. The Vendor Managed Inventory Analyst III work is generally independent and collaborative in nature. Contributes to moderately complex aspects of a project. To be a Vendor Managed Inventory Analyst III typically requires 4-7 years of related experience.
